Tutorial by Examples: me

This UNION ALL combines data from multiple tables and serve as a table name alias to use for your queries: SELECT YEAR(date_time_column), MONTH(date_time_column), MIN(DATE(date_time_column)), MAX(DATE(date_time_column)), COUNT(DISTINCT (ip)), COUNT(ip), (COUNT(ip) / COUNT(DISTINCT (ip))) AS Ratio ...
First of all, the problem of handling spaces in arguments is NOT actually a Java problem. Rather it is a problem that needs to be handled by the command shell that you are using when you run a Java program. As an example, let us suppose that we have the following simple program that prints the siz...
Sinse structs are value types all the data is copied on assignment, and any modification to the new copy does not change the data for the original copy. The code snippet below shows that p1 is copied to p2 and changes made on p1 does not affect p2 instance. var p1 = new Point { x = 1, y =...
To Import Google(Gmail) contacts in ASP.NET MVC application, first download "Google API setup" This will grant the following references: using Google.Contacts; using Google.GData.Client; using Google.GData.Contacts; using Google.GData.Extensions; Add these to the relevant applicatio...
Suppose you have a button in your Java program that counts down a time. Here is the code for 10 minutes timer. private final static long REFRESH_LIST_PERIOD=10 * 60 * 1000; //10 minutes Timer timer = new Timer(1000, new ActionListener() { @Override public void actionPerformed(ActionEve...
Create a class name ErrorMatcher inside your test package with below code: public class ErrorMatcher { @NonNull public static Matcher<View> withError(final String expectedErrorText) { Checks.checkNotNull(expectedErrorText); return new BoundedMatcher<View, ...
String macros do not come with built-in interpolation facilities. However, it is possible to manually implement this functionality. Note that it is not possible to embed without escaping string literals that have the same delimiter as the surrounding string macro; that is, although ""&quot...
What is a metaclass? In Python, everything is an object: integers, strings, lists, even functions and classes themselves are objects. And every object is an instance of a class. To check the class of an object x, one can call type(x), so: >>> type(5) <type 'int'> >>> typ...
You may have heard that everything in Python is an object. It is true, and all objects have a class: >>> type(1) int The literal 1 is an instance of int. Lets declare a class: >>> class Foo(object): ... pass ... Now lets instantiate it: >>> bar = Foo() Wh...
module main; auto getMemberNames(T)() @safe pure { string[] members; foreach (derived; __traits(derivedMembers, T)) { members ~= derived; } return members; } class Foo { int a; int b; } class Bar : Foo { int c; int d; int e...
A Consumer can only await values from upstream. type Consumer a = Proxy () a () X await :: Monad m => Consumer a m a For example: fancyPrint :: MonadIO m => Consumer String m () fancyPrint = forever $ do numStr <- await liftIO $ putStrLn ("I received: " ++ numStr) ...
pipes's core data type is the Proxy monad transformer. Pipe, Producer, Consumer and so on are defined in terms of Proxy. Since Proxy is a monad transformer, definitions of Pipes take the form of monadic scripts which await and yield values, additionally performing effects from the base monad m.
Mocking an interface that inherits from IEnumerable to return canned data is quite straightforward. Assuming the following classes: public class DataClass { public int Id { get; set; } } public interface IEnumerableClass : IEnumerable<DataClass> { } The following approach can ...
NumericUpDown is control that looks like TextBox. This control allow user to display/select number from a range. Up and Down arrows are updating the textbox value. Control look like; In Form_Load range can be set. private void Form3_Load(object sender, EventArgs e) { numericUpDown...
This example illustrates how to read various-type struct entries from MATLAB, and pass it to C equivalent type variables. While it is possible and easy to figure out from the example how to load fields by numbers, it is here achieved via comparing the field names to strings. Thus the struct fields ...
Import Element Tree module import xml.etree.ElementTree as ET Element() function is used to create XML elements p=ET.Element('parent') SubElement() function used to create sub-elements to a give element c = ET.SubElement(p, 'child1') dump() function is used to dump xml elements. ET.dump...
The default directory is the home directory ($HOME, typically /home/username), so cd without any directory takes you there cd Or you could be more explicit: cd $HOME A shortcut for the home directory is ~, so that could be used as well. cd ~
-- SQL 2005+ exec sp_addrolemember @rolename = 'myRole', @membername = 'aUser'; exec sp_droprolemember @rolename = 'myRole', @membername = 'aUser'; -- SQL 2008+ ALTER ROLE [myRole] ADD MEMBER [aUser]; ALTER ROLE [myRole] DROP MEMBER [aUser]; Note: role members can be any database-level pri...
Sometimes a build combines multiple source directories, each of which is their own 'project'. For instance, you might have a build structure like this: projectName/ build.sbt project/ src/ main/ ... test/ ... core/ src/ main/ ... test/ ... webapp/ src/ main/ ... test/ ... In t...
Abstract base classes (ABCs) enforce what derived classes implement particular methods from the base class. To understand how this works and why we should use it, let's take a look at an example that Van Rossum would enjoy. Let's say we have a Base class "MontyPython" with two methods (jo...

Page 135 of 197